The Fn Key: Your Gateway to Enhanced Functionality

The Fn key, short for “function,” acts as a modifier key, working in conjunction with other keys to activate secondary functions. These functions are often represented by icons printed on the keyboard, usually above the standard key labels.

Understanding the Fn Key Behavior

The behavior of the Fn key can vary depending on your Dell laptop model and operating system. Here are some common scenarios:
Fn Key as a Toggle: On some Dell laptops, the Fn key acts as a toggle. Pressing Fn once activates the secondary functions for the corresponding keys. Pressing Fn again deactivates them.
Fn Key as a Modifier: On other Dell laptops, the Fn key acts as a modifier, meaning you need to hold down the Fn key while pressing another key to activate the secondary function.
Fn Lock: Some Dell laptops offer an Fn Lock feature. This feature allows you to permanently activate the secondary functions assigned to the Fn key. This means you no longer need to hold down the Fn key to access these functions. The Fn Lock key is typically located near the Fn key or in the function row.

How to Find Your Dell Laptop’s Fn Key Functions

If you’re unsure what functions are assigned to the Fn key on your specific Dell laptop, here are a couple of ways to find out:
1. Check the Keyboard: Look for icons printed above the function keys (F1-F12). These icons usually represent the secondary functions associated with each key when used in combination with the Fn key.
2. Consult the User Manual: Your Dell laptop’s user manual will provide a comprehensive list of all the Fn key combinations and their corresponding functions. You can usually find a digital copy of your user manual on Dell’s website.

What People Want to Know

Q: My Fn key doesn‘t seem to be working. What should I do?
A: If your Fn key isn‘t working, check the following:

  • Fn Lock: Make sure Fn Lock is not enabled.
  • Driver Issues: Try updating your laptop’s keyboard drivers.
  • Physical Damage: Inspect the Fn key for any physical damage or debris.
  • System Restart: Try restarting your Dell laptop.
